LLM Models

Manage which models this organization can use.

Configuring Model Access

The models available to your organization are displayed in a table. Use the toggle switch on the right side of each model to enable or disable it.

  • Enabled: Organization members can select and use this model in chat.
  • Disabled: This model is removed from the model selection list in chat.

Enabling Auto Router

Auto Router is a model that automatically selects a model based on the user’s request and conversation context. It is disabled by default. To let organization members use Auto Router in chat, an administrator must enable it first.

To enable Auto Router, turn on the Auto Router toggle in the model list, then click Save Changes in the top-right corner. After the change is saved, Auto Router appears in the chat model selector for organization members.

The models used for each Auto Router tier are currently set by the system and cannot be changed from this page.


Behavior When a Model Is Disabled

  • Chat: If a model previously selected by a user is disabled, they are automatically switched to the default model.
  • Agent: Only models permitted by the organization are shown in agent settings. If a model assigned to an agent is disabled, execution is blocked and an error is returned at runtime.

Saving Changes

After making changes, click the Save Changes button in the top-right corner to apply them.

Note: If you attempt to leave the page with unsaved changes, a warning will appear to prevent accidental data loss.
